Click OK to apply conditional formatting. This is how it looks: =G4=TODAY () The formula returns a Boolean value. If the cell value (G4) is equal to result of TODAY function, which returns the present day in a date format, the formula returns TRUE. Jan 31, 2009 ... You can customize the number of rows and columns to fit the size of the calendar you need.Jul 6, 2017 · There are a few ways to create a calendar table in Excel. One of the easiest ways is to use Power Query (Get & Transform). We can use a custom query to generate the entire table based on a start and end date. The query will create the Date column (primary key) with a list of unique dates, and also create the additional metadata columns with the ... To make the calendar dynamic (supports user interaction), we should provide two cells to input the month and year. So when changing those values, the calendar will update. Create headings for the days of the week: In the first row of your worksheet, label each column with the days of the week (e.g., Monday, Tuesday, Wednesday, etc.). This will make it easier to organize and visualize your calendar data. Add dates for each day: In the rows below the days of the week, input the dates for each day of the month.
